Time Laws
Time laws are principles or rules that govern the nature and behavior of time. In physics, time laws are often associated with the theory of relativity formulated by Albert Einstein. According to this theory, time is not absolute but is relative and can be influenced by factors such as gravity and velocity.
One of the key time laws is the concept of time dilation, where time appears to pass at different rates for observers in different frames of reference. This phenomenon has been experimentally verified and has significant implications for our understanding of the universe.
Fixed Points
Fixed points are specific moments or events in time that remain constant or unchanging. These points serve as reference markers and are used to establish a standard for measuring time intervals or durations.
In mathematics, fixed points are solutions to equations where a function maps a point to itself. Fixed points play a critical role in various mathematical theorems and are essential for understanding the behavior of dynamical systems.
